In 2012 a ballot measure known as “Question 7” asked voters in Maryland if they wanted to legalize gambling casinos in Prince George’s County. This sign is asking residents to vote YES, and support the legalization of gambling casinos. Supporters say tax revenue from casinos would improve funding for local schools. Detractors say it would encourage gambling addiction.
